Acrobat DC cannot find scanner

Community Beginner ,
Aug 15, 2016 Aug 15, 2016

My OS is Windows 10 pro version 1511 (64bit)

When I try to scan something from my Samsung ProXpress M3870FW acrobat says it

cannot find my scanner.  Does acrobat have problems with 32 & 64 bit windows versions,

32 or 64 bit acrobat versions, or 32 or 64 bit scanner drivers?  I have trouble shot this

problem to death and still can't get it to work. HELP?

Hi falcon68 ,

Could you please tell if you are able to scan from Scanner's native interface?

Try to perform following steps :.

1- Restart the Computer and the Scanner and then check if you are able to scan.

2- Try to check if there is an update available for Acrobat, Launch Acrobat, click on Help menu>then Check for updates.If there is an update available , download and install it and check if you are able to scan from Acrobat DC.

3- If step 2 doesn't fix the issue , please visit here : Troubleshooting tips for scanner issues when using Acrobat  and here :  Acrobat DC unable to find the scanner connected to Windows 10 Home but Windows can .
